Canada Student Grant for Full-Time Students

The Canada Student Grant for Full-Time Students provides up to $4,200 per year in non-repayable federal funding to eligible full-time students with demonstrated financial need. It is automatically calculated when you apply for student loans through your provincial student aid office — no separate federal application is needed.

Amount: Up to $4,200 per year Type: Non-repayable grant Study status: Full-time (60%+ of a full course load) Basis: Financial need

Who qualifies

The grant is available to students enrolled full-time at a designated post-secondary institution with demonstrated financial need.

  • Full-time enrolment (at least 60% of a full course load)
  • Canadian citizen, permanent resident, or protected person
  • Financial need as assessed by your provincial student aid office
  • Not available to students in Quebec, Nunavut, or NWT (those provinces/territories have opted out)

Your provincial student aid office assesses need by subtracting your expected resources (family income, personal income, assets) from your expected cost of study (tuition, books, housing). The shortfall determines grant and loan eligibility.
